Professional, Scientific, and Technical Services in Dayton-Kettering-Beavercreek, OH
Metro Market Score 66.1 (Difficult), ranked #217 of 261 metros. 2,738 establishments, 27,085 jobs.
Metro Market Assessment
Lower is better. Relative to national professional, scientific, and technical services average.
Market conditions for professional, scientific, and technical services in Dayton-Kettering-Beavercreek are tougher than average. The 66.1 market score reflects a combination of high labor costs, mixed growth signals, and an already crowded field. Rank: #217 of 261 metros.

Dayton-Kettering-Beavercreek vs Ohio Statewide
How this metro's professional, scientific, and technical services market compares to Ohio overall. The state ranks #17/51 for entry risk.
| Measure | Dayton-Kettering-Beavercreek | OH Statewide |
|---|---|---|
| Overall Score | 66.1 Difficult | 36.9 Moderate |
| Score Type | Metro Market Score | Entry Risk Score |
| Rank | #217 of 261 metros | #17 of 51 states |
Metro and state scores use different methodologies (metro has 4 QCEW-based metrics; state adds BDS survival and momentum data). Direct score comparisons are approximate.
